Interprets a wide variety of clinical and diagnostic documentation in order to process hospital and / or pro-fee charges for episodes of outpatient care. Assigns appropriate ICD-CM (current edition) and CPT codes as well as modifiers. Based on account type, may assign ICD-PCS codes, as appropriate adhering to official coding guidelines.

Responsibilities

  • Upon review of the medical record, performs analysis on documentation, which includes review of tests / reports to determine the appropriate ICD-CM (current edition) and / or CPT codes as well as modifiers. Based on account type, may assign ICD-PCS codes, as defined by official coding guidelines and other recognized reference materials.
  • Verifies documentation is present to substantiate codes assigned.
  • Assists in resolving incomplete and / or missing chart documentation in order to expedite coding and billing.
  • Participates in the continuous coding audit and performance management program.
  • Maintains coding accuracy rate of not less than 95% for optimal reimbursement as well as department productivity standards as outlined in department policies.
  • Attends required training classes and coding in-services each year to stay abreast of new regulations and coding guidelines.
  • Participates in improvement efforts and documentation training for medical and clinical staff as it relates to coding practices and guidelines.
  • Communicates to Manager when backlog situations arise or necessary documents are either incorrect or are not being received in a timely manner.
  • Refers all unusual, questionable situations to the direct Manager.
  • Alerts management to any coding irregularities, or trends contrary to policies / procedures, so corrective measures may be taken.
  • Adheres to the coding and billing regulations established by the American Hospital Association (AHA), American Medical Association (AMA), and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S).
  • Maintains direct and ongoing communications with other coding personnel to maximize overall effectiveness and efficiency of the operation.
  • Keeps current with all coding updates and information related to correct coding.
